Why this rating

This daycare earned 4 out of 5 stars overall. Process quality reflects an Early Achievers rating of Level 3 (out of 5). Structural quality reflects a license in good standing. The structural rating also includes Washington's licensing baseline — what every licensed daycare in the state must meet. Washington caps infant ratios at 1:4, toddler ratios at 1:7, and preschool ratios at 1:10. Lead teachers must hold a Child Development Associate (CDA). Teachers must complete 10 hours of annual training.

Across 1 inspection since 2026, the issues cited most often were Hazardous Materials Handling (2). None of the 2 findings were critical.

See the Inspection Visit
  1. May 18, 20262 Findings2 Important
    • This Section of the Inspection Report Lists Non-compliances Found During Any Licensing Inspection. Information From This Section Will Be Reported to Child Care…110-300-0165(3)

      0165(3)(g) Outdoor area: two chairs had cracked seats and were in poor condition. They need to be kept inaccessible to children. Both chairs were removed during the on-site on 05/18/2026. / Area de afuera: dos sillas tenían los asientos agrietados y se encontraban en mal estado. Deben mantenerse fuera del alcance de los niños. Las dos sillas se removieron y se corrigio durante la visita en persona.

    • An Early Learning Provider Must Take Steps to Prevent Hazards to Children Including, but Not Limited To: (D) Making Inaccessible to Children Plastic Bags and Ot…Serious: 110-300-0165(2)

      0165(2)(d) Preschool 2: in the gray plastic cabinet, there was a roll of large plastic bags on the lower shelf that was accessible to childcare children. The teacher removed the bags and placed them in the bathroom cabinet, which has a plastic latch and is inaccessible to children. Corrected on-site on 05/18/2026. / En el armario de plástico gris, había un rollo de bolsas de plástico grandes en el estante inferior, el cual estaba al alcance de los niños.
